Research

The main research interest is addressed at the travel literature (reportages, diary, autobiographies) in the Italian literature of  twentieth century.  The critical point of view assumed the most recent contribute of cultural and postcolonial studies. This interest is connected with the analysis of the concept of “translation”, in the field of comparative  literature, and the effects produced by migration literature on the canon of Italian literature.

A second field of research is concerned with the writing of history, especially the intersection between historiography reconstruction of the past and fictive construction  in the contemporary novel. In short, it means to configure the changing forms of historical novel in Italy,  think about the hybridisation with others genre (detective story, docu-drama, fact-fiction) and abuot the debate of the history's ending and the post modern literature.
